Tracking Technologies and Cookies
We use cookies and third-party services such as Google AdSense to serve ads, analyze site traffic, and store information. Technologies used include:
- Cookies or Browser Cookies: Small files stored on Your Device to remember preferences or track usage. You can configure Your browser to refuse cookies but some Service features may not work without them.
- Web Beacons: Small electronic files used to count visits and track user interaction with pages or emails.
Cookies can be Session Cookies (deleted when the browser closes) or Persistent Cookies (remain on Your device until deleted).
We use cookies for the following purposes:
- Necessary / Essential Cookies (Session Cookies) Administered by Us. These cookies authenticate users and enable core Service features.
- Cookies Policy / Notice Acceptance Cookies (Persistent Cookies) Administered by Us. These cookies identify if You have accepted our cookie use policy.
- Functionality Cookies (Persistent Cookies) Administered by Us. These cookies remember Your choices such as login details or language preference.
